Memo to Finance — Halloway Term Sheet

Team, the term sheet from Halloway Ventures landed yesterday and it's mostly sensible. Headline: growth investment in exchange for a minority stake, board observer seat, and standard protective provisions. The valuation is a touch below our internal model, but the drag-along terms are cleaner than the Perrin offer. Gwen is redlining the liquidation preference language this week. Please stress-test the dilution scenarios before Thursday. How we respond depends on the plan outlined below.

management briefing: The renewal with Zoraelax Group closes at $10 million a year, 15 percent below the last contract. Project Ralael slips by six weeks because of the audit delay.

Handover for the Quindle autoscaler, from Maret to whoever holds the pager. The queue-depth signal comes from the Brillo broker; scaling triggers at 500 messages sustained over two minutes. Watch for the flapping bug when consumers restart — I've pinned max replicas at 12 as a guard. If the scaler config store locks you out, recover it with the passphrase below.

vault phrase of tajop-haduf = holath-brivan-wenax

To: Sales Leads
From: Outgoing Director Tessa Quarn; Incoming Director Abel Rosk

This note records the state of the divestiture of our Bellstone Calibration unit to Havrel Technical. Heads of terms are signed; due diligence runs six weeks. Sales leads should continue quoting Bellstone services normally and route any customer questions to the transition desk. Pipeline ownership transfers at closing; commissions on open deals are protected. Abel assumes oversight next Monday. The confidential note on related business plans appears below.

internal memo for hafog-hadug: The pricing group signed off on a budget of $16.1 million for Project Gorir. The renewal with Oliionax Systems closes at $14.1 million a year, 46 percent above the last contract.

- [ ] **Step 7: Breaker override escrow.** After sealing the signing keys for the Tallgrove upstream API circuit breaker, confirm the support team can force the breaker open during a full outage. The override bundle lives in the sealed escrow drawer and is useless without its unlock phrase. Two ceremony witnesses must initial this step before proceeding. The escrow bundle is decrypted with the recovery passphrase that follows.

vault phrase of kahip-kahop = holath-quenmir